I want to set my smart list to tag any prospect that clicks the "add to my calendar" token.  When I use the drop down list within the "link is" section, Marketo is only pulling the actual URL links and not the calendar link.  Is there a way to set the smart list to capture that click on the calendar list?

Do you have other links in the email? Perhaps you could do a Smart List that says "Clicks Link in Email" and then add an additional contraint "Link is NOT" and list the other links.

You need to exclude other links (Link is NOT) for the smart list to show only leads that clicked on the calendar token.
I have no idea why the token is not included in the links drop down, but it would be nice addition.
